In the equation y = 1/2x + 3, when x is 2, what is y?

Answer: y=4

Step-by-step explanation:

y=1/2 x 2+3

y=1/2x2 + 3 (cancel the 2's) if you want to check if is correct take your calculator and do: 1/2 X 2

y=1+3

y=4
